I discovered this forum a few months ago, and then the pandemic hit and I’ve been stressed out and distracted. I thought I would just say hello. I’ve had MD since childhood. It is like an addiction, like I can’t be satisfied with myself or the world in general and need to live in an alternate reality. It’s interesting to see how others have the same struggles, but also, how they experience it differently from me. I don’t really have separate characters, more like an idealized self that does everything right (opposite of reality!). Thank you for providing this forum.
